Red Bull advisor Helmut Marko has detailed that Oscar Piastri had a role in the events that led to Max Verstappen ‘s race collapsing in Formula 1 ‘s Spanish Grand Prix. Verstappen was poised to come home third behind the McLarens in Barcelona until a Safety Car with 11 laps to go triggered chaos that saw him end up down in 10th.
